Ophthalmoscopy, also known as fundus examination, is a diagnostic procedure used to assess the health of the retina, optic disc, and other structures at the back of the eye. It is crucial for detecting eye conditions such as glaucoma, macular degeneration, and diabetic retinopathy.

Technique options
Direct ophthalmoscopy — uses a handheld device to view the back of the eye.
Indirect ophthalmoscopy — provides a wider view of the retina using a head-mounted device and a light source.

Honest information
Ophthalmoscopy is a safe and non-invasive diagnostic procedure. However, there are minimal risks associated with the test.
Temporary blurred vision
Vision may be blurred due to dilating eye drops. This typically resolves within a few hours.
Light sensitivity
Increased sensitivity to light may occur after pupil dilation.
Allergic reaction
Rarely, an allergic reaction to the dilating drops can occur.
If something concerns you at home
Avoid bright lights following the test until your pupils return to normal size. Sunglasses may be helpful.
